Heritage Prairie Farm brings weekly organic produce to community

Heritage Prairie Farm brings the best in local produce and eggs to the community with their Community Supported Agriculture (CSA) program.

Participating in their CSA program allows the community to incorporate fresh, local, certified organic produce into their diet.

Organically fed, free-range chicken eggs are also available to add to any CSA share.

CSA members take advantage of seasonal produce, heirloom varietals of produce not available at the local grocer, and reduced carbon footprint by buying locally.

Local produce also packs the highest content of nutrients by going directly from the land to your CSA box.

In addition, CSA members also receive discounted prices on Heritage Prairie Farm's monthly Farm Dinners, a free tote bag for their pickup, and a free cookbook at their first pickup.

Varied pickup times and locations available for some shares, to make it convenient for anyone in the community to take part in the program.
